Removing
1. Raise the car on a lift.
2. Turn away two nuts and remove bolts, washers and rubber plugs from racks of the stabilizer with spherical hinges.
3. Remove the cotter pin and loosen the castle nut a few turns.
4. Release the strut pivot using tool LRT-57-018 as shown.
5. Remove the castle nut and remove the strut.
Installation
1. Install the stand and screw on the castle nut. Make sure the ball joint strut is facing up. Tighten the nut to 40 Nm and install a new cotter pin.
2. Connect the anti-roll bar to the uprights.
3. Screw in bolts, install washers and rubber bushings, and screw in new self-locking nuts to secure the anti-roll bar to the uprights. Tighten the fasteners to 68 Nm.
4. Lower the car.
